Here is my take on the moodboard:

Using paper from the  49 and Market Vintage Artistry Everyday collection, I fussy cut some leaves first from the Zealous paper and used the paper Garden Variety as my base. I then paint all the chipboard, before putting my layout together. Firstly, I added layers of different paper and ephemera behind my photo. The Ornate Circle frame off DA2271 is the smaller of the two frames in the pack, plus I have used the negative of the circle between the large and smaller frame. These were painted in green and I added touches of Prima wax to these. I adhered these to the page first before adding my photo and paper layers.
The flower clusters were then built up, and I added the mini film strips DA2511, the small wildflowers #3 DA1143, a bee DA1669 and a mini watering can DA2802 into the cluster



And isn't this quote sentiment off Sentiment pack #4 DA2585 just fabulous "make today so awesome that yesterday gets jealous" - I love it!
Once I completed the layout I added splatters of bronze paint to the layout.

I am back today with a layout created using the newly released Vintage Artistry Naturalist collection. 

The base of my layout is the paper called Meadow. I then made a "look a like book" using some of the Naturalist Ephemera and the Bookplates. This has been made with foam tape layers to create the book. The flower cluster is made using the Cranberry Rustic Bouquet flowers, added with laser cut leaves abd flowers from the 12 x 12 collection pack.
The little heart in the flowers is off the chipboard stickers. 
The title of "walk on the wild side" is off the laser cut sheet.

I have tucked tags on either side of the booklet and then added rubon stitching of the Naturalist rubons, and I have also added rubon leaves above the booklet and also in the top right corner of the page.
The "lace" at the top of the page is off the bar code strip of the Meadows paper which I have fussy on the edges to create the lace edge adhering to the page, and added rubon stitching to the lace.

The embellishment at the top of the page is made using the chipboard stickers, firstly the round chipboard that reads "outside" then adding the elastic ribbon off the laser cut sheets with foam tape and then adding the chipboard "joy in living"
